How Can I get workflow and workflow history for current Item using Sitecore API Item Service?

Get item details using below query

Query to get Item

/item/{id}/database&language&version&includeStandardTemplateFields&includeMetadata&fields

Json Result

{
          "ItemID": "25a40733-babf-4f16-a025-a3ffb0c84c05",
          "ItemName": "itemName",
          "ItemPath": "/sitecore/content/Home",
          "ParentID": "59b7047e-1063-4f2e-a452-4ca466ecb621",
          "TemplateID": "3191fecf-905e-4ca1-a007-05ba9f5b7455",
          "TemplateName": "templatename",
          "CloneSource": null,
          "ItemLanguage": "en",
          "ItemVersion": "1",
          "DisplayName": "testuser",
          "HasChildren": "True",
 }

in the above result don't have the workflow details.

You would need to double check but I think you have 2 options here:

  1. Set includeStandardTemplateFields parameter to true (includeStandardTemplateFields=true):
/item/{id}/database&language&version&includeStandardTemplateFields=true&includeMetadata&fields

In this case you should get all the fields of the item.

  1. Set fields parameter to the "," separated fields you want to receive from api (fields=__Workflow,__Workflow%20state,__Display_name):
/item/{id}/database&language&version&includeStandardTemplateFields=true&includeMetadata&fields=__Workflow,__Workflow%20state,__Display_name

In this case you will only get the fields from the parameter.

In both scenarios you will not get the full workflow history anyway. I don't think that's possible with Sitecore API Item Service.

It does not return Workflow history, but you can check the current workflow state information. Inclde below querystring to get all possible values from the ItemService API:

includeStandardTemplateFields=true (default value is false)

sitecore/api/ssc/item/87D9ADCB-08CE-4396-86C4-8BAE04D833F7/?database=master&includeStandardTemplateFields=true
